SYNOPSIS
-
Serenity hurtles through space. Onboard,
the crew mulls around while discussing Ariel, a core planet. Shepherd
Book is not present, as he’s been dropped off to meditate at an Abbey.
Zoë says she's not getting off the ship: too many Feds. Mal says
nobody's getting off the ship. They're dropping off Inara so she can
renew her Companion's license. Guild law requires an annual physical for
all companions.
Cleaning his guns, Jayne spits on them. Simon asks him not to, but he
does anyway. Suddenly, River picks up a butcher's knife and slashes
Jayne across the chest. In the infirmary, as Simon is stitching him up,
Jayne tells Mal the siblings have to go before she kills somebody. Mal
refuses, but tells Simon that River is completely confined to her room.
Later, Mal and Jayne complain that they have no job to do while waiting
on Inara. Simon says if the crew helps him get River into the hospital's
diagnostic ward, he'll help them get into the hospital vault and tell
them what medicines to steal (to later sell on the street for huge
money). Simon wants to get River into a 3-D neuro-imager to find out
what they did to her at the Academy.
Simon reveals his plan to sneak into the hospital unnoticed. Kaylee and
Wash will build an ambulance ship from old scrap parts, and Mal, Zoë and
Jayne will pose as medics. They'll be carrying Simon and River, who will
be induced into unconsciousness to seem like corpses.
The 'ambulance' touches down at the hospital and the plan is underway.
Jayne assures Mal that he's okay with Simon's plan. The on-duty nurse
sends our crew down to the morgue. Mal gives River and Simon an
injection that will revive them in a few minutes, then he and Zoë depart
for the vault. After a moment, Jayne walks down the hall to a telephone
and calls the police. The officer asks if Jayne has the fugitives, and
Jayne asks if the officer has his reward.
Jayne heads back to the morgue, where River and Simon come to. Up in the
hallways, Mal and Zoë are pushing their gurneys towards the vault when a
doctor stops them, asking to see Mal's badge. Meanwhile, as Simon and
Jayne wheel River through a patient wing, a patient begins having a
heart attack. Simon jumps in and saves the man's life.
Back in the hallway, the doctor orders Mal and Zoë to follow him. He
begins yelling at them, but Zoë shocks him with the paddles, knocking
him out. They take off for the vault and get in using the doctor's ID
card.
Simon lays River down in the neuro-imager and kicks it on. In the vault,
Mal and Zoë begin cleaning house according to Simon's shopping list.
They load up the gurneys, close the lids and take off.
Simon begins scanning River. A hologram of her brain appears over her.
Simon is shocked by what he sees. He says they cut into her brain, over
and over, removing the part that allows her to suppress feelings. Jayne
tries to rush out the group. Simon says they have twenty more minutes,
but Jayne says the plan changed while Simon was out, Captain's orders.
The group moves outside, where Federal marshals are waiting for them.
Jayne asks the officer he spoke with how they want to handle things. The
marshals arrest Jayne for aiding and abetting fugitives. Jayne asks
about his money. The officer says it's his money now.
Mal and Zoë make it back to the 'ambulance.' Mal wonders where the rest
of the group is. They're inside, being held by the marshals. Outside,
Mal realizes something is up. He and Zoë arm themselves and look for a
way to sneak in the back.
The marshals transfer their captives into a holding room and Jayne goes
on the attack. He knocks out one guard and kills another. Mal and Zoë
hustle through the hospital. Kaylee and Wash radio directions to them.
Two sinister men, dressed in black suits, show up and interrogate the
arresting officer. When the suited men find out the officer spoke with
the captives, one of the men pulls a blue wand device out of his pocket
and triggers it. The arresting officer begins to bleed from every
orifice, as well as his fingernails.
Inside the holding room, Jayne, Simon and River hear the men screaming
outside. The screaming continues until the suited men have killed all of
the marshals. The group takes off in the other direction. They're unsure
of where they're going, but it's away from the screaming. The suited men
find the guard that Jayne knocked unconscious and bleed him to death as
well.
The trio finds a door, but it's locked. Jayne tries to blast it open,
but his stolen weapon malfunctions. The suited men are rapidly
approaching. Jayne tries to break the door open when the handle is
blasted off from the other side. Mal and Zoë are standing there.
The 'ambulance' arrives back on Serenity just in time to meet
Inara, who has also returned. The entire crew is safe. Simon is
optimistic about a possible treatment for River, based on the data he
collected. Simon thanks Jayne for saving them. After the crew leaves,
Mal and Jayne begins to unload the pilfered medicine. When Jayne turns
around, Mal cracks him in the face with a wrench, knocking him out cold.
When Jayne comes to, he's locked in the cargo hold with a radio. From
the other side, Mal opens the cargo bay door and asks Jayne why he went
out the back. He knows Jayne called the Feds. Jayne denies it
vehemently.
Mal says if Jayne turns on any of his crew, he turns on Mal. Worried
that he's about to be sucked out the door when the ship pressurizes,
Jayne asks Mal to not tell the crew what he did. Mal walks upstairs, but
not before closing the cargo bay door. He leaves Jayne in the cargo hold
to think about what he did.
River sits quietly drawing as Simon approaches to give her an injection.
She asks if it’s time to go to sleep again. He smiles and says that it’s
time to wake up.
TRIVIA
-
Despite his appearance on the opening titles, Ron
Glass does not appear in this episode.
-
Ira Steck, the young intern in the hospital, also
appeared as Richard in Buffy's
Lies My Parents Told Me.
CONTINUITY
-
The
Blue-Gloved Men from
The Train Job
are back. They don’t get River again, but they return in the
Serenity
comic book series.
-
There
is a vast reward for the Tam’s capture, which Jayne attempts to exploit.
Seemingly, Jubal Early from
Objects in Space
is after the same thing.
-
River
slashes not at Jayne’s chest, but at the Blue Sun logo in his shirt. She
did the same to the labels on the cans in
The Train Job.
-
Book is mentioned at being off ship during this episode, at an Abbey
they passed at some point before this episode, presumably in Core Planet
territory.
